Oslo Akvarieklubb is Norway's oldest aquarium club and aims to gather aquarium enthusiasts in and around Oslo. The club offers an active community for members who share an interest in aquarism. Various member meetings are organized throughout the year, where lectures and auctions are held. One of the big events is the autumn's big auction, which gives members the opportunity to buy and sell aquarium equipment.
In addition to auctions, the club organizes themed evenings such as an aquarium pub evening, where exciting lectures about fish are presented. The Christmas meeting is also a tradition, where the members gather to enjoy prawns and loaf. The club has a library of resources available to those interested in aquariums, and focuses on breeding and conservation of various fish species.
